Set the pan level for the selected
channel on the selected device.
Devices >
Audio Mixer
Audio Mixer Pan
1. Click Audio Pan.
2. Click the Audio Mixer button
and select the device you want
to send the command to.
3. Click the Channel button and
select the channel you want to
send the command to.
4. Click the Change Type button
and select whether you want to
set (Absolute) or reset (Reset)
the parameter. Some selections
will not be available when you
reset the parameter.
5. Enter the new pan level in the
Pan Left/Right (%) field.
Set the level for the selected channel
on the selected device.
Devices >
Audio Mixer
Audio Mixer
Volume
1. Click Audio Volume.
2. Click the Audio Mixer button
and select the device you want
to send the command to.
3. Click the Channel button and
select the channel you want to
send the command to.
4. Click the Change Type button
and select whether you want to
set (Absolute) or reset (Reset)
the parameter. Some selections
will not be available when you
reset the parameter.
5. Enter the new audio level in the
Volume (%) field.

Initialize a chroma key for the selected
key for the selected ME or MiniME
™
.
Switcher >
Keyer >
Chroma Keyer
Init
Chroma Key,
Initialize
1. Click the ME button and select
the ME, MiniME
™
, or
MultiScreen that you want to
perform the event on.
2. Click the Keyer button for the
key you want to perform the
event on.
Select the color you want to key out
for the selected key for the selected
ME or MiniME
™
.
Switcher >
Keyer >
Chroma Keyer
Color
Chroma Key Color
1. Click the ME button and select
the ME, MiniME
™
, or
MultiScreen that you want to
perform the event on.
2. Click the Keyer button for the
key you want to perform the
event on.
3. Click Color and select the color
you want to key out.
Select the mode for a chroma key for
the selected key for the selected ME
or MiniME
™
.
Switcher >
Keyer >
Chroma Keyer
Mode
Chroma Key Mode
1. Click the ME button and select
the ME, MiniME
™
, or
MultiScreen that you want to
perform the event on.
2. Click the Keyer button for the
key you want to perform the
event on.
3. Click a Mode button to select
whether you want the chroma
key to operate in basic mode
(Basic), or advanced
(Advanced).
Select the various advanced chroma
key settings for the selected key for
the selected ME or MiniME
™
.
Switcher >
Keyer >
Chroma Keyer
Param
Chroma Key Setup
1. Click the ME button and select
the ME, MiniME
™
, or
MultiScreen that you want to
perform the event on.
2. Click the Keyer button for the
key you want to perform the
event on.
3. Click the Parameter button and
select the parameter you want
to adjust.
4. Click the Value button and select
the new value you want to enter
for the selected parameter.
